Transaction 1abffbda148f81dd8a67dd37f875427fb349ec7347410011a112ba7dc155d6bd
1 Input
1 Output
-
1abffbda148f81dd8a67dd37f875427fb349ec7347410011a112ba7dc155d6bd:0
- value
- 445037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85f04e9e3917f3558ce1b70dbb55226513884e02 OP_EQUAL
- address
- 3DuDftRHkBc2LQKCqUJep4Krr2zxbzorB5